All beans are gluten free when they are minimally processed (e.g when you buy them dried, or tinned in water). However "baked beans" are not necessarily gluten free.

No, soy does not contain gluten. Soy comes from a legume called the soybean and is not a wheat grain where gluten is found.

Tofu does not contain gluten as long as it is the plain kind. Several types of flavored tofu do contain gluten.
